Should new writers start with short stories before writing a novel?
The short story is a great way to learn about the elements of craft. You can explore and refine characterization, conflict, point of view, and setting, all of which are important in both the short story and the novel. And you can even experiment more widely, tackling a first person point of view in one story, for example, and third person in another. Writing a short story isnt easier than writing a novel. In fact, some writers find the short story more difficult. But exploring and experimenting in the bounds of a seven page story rather than a two hundred page novel can feel more manageable to newer writers. It can also help you develop an understanding of your individual skills and preferences as a writer. However, there are significant differences between short stories and novels. Conflict, for example, must be introduced, developed, and resolved quickly in a short story, whereas a novel demands a broader scope and more development to sustain tension.
